您的位置:首页 > 编程语言 > PHP开发

PHP与JAVA做WEB开发的一些区别

2009-01-29 09:33 281 查看
一.SESSION使用方法的区别

PHP中的SESSION的使用方法:1.每次使用SESSION必须使用SESSION_START();2.注册SESSION使用SESSION_REGISTER();3.SESSION初始化使用$_SESSION["SESSION名"];4.SESSION使用完后须使用UNSET()或SESSION_UNREGISTER()方法关闭SESSION.(其中第2,4点在某些版本的浏览器中可以不使用,只要启动SESSION和初始化SESSION就可以了)

JAVA中的SESSION的使用方法:1.在SERVLET中,使用REQUEST.GETSESSION(TRUE).SETATTRIBUTE("SESSION名", 初始值)注册并初始化SESSION(只有在第一次注册SESSION时GETSESSION方法使用TRUE属性);使用REQUEST.GETSESSION().GETATTRIBUTE("SESSION名")获得SESSION值.2.在JSP中:使用SESSION.GETATTRIBUTE("SESSION名")获得SESSION值;

二.页面提示的区别

PHP中页面提示:使用ECHO方法弹出提示信息,页面重定向使用HEAD("页面跳转地址")方法.

JAVA中页面提示:使用REQUEST.GETWRITER().PRINTLN()方法弹出提示信息,页面重定向使用REQUEST.SENDREDIRECT("页面跳转地址")方法.

三.错误信息提示

PHP中错误信息提示:一般仅仅出现在语法和SQL语句处.

JAVA中错误信息提示:采用逐层报错的形式,故采用JAVA平台中的特有纠错方式—调试(DEBUG);大体操作功能键有F5代表STEP INTO进入目标方法的方法体内、F6代表STEP OVER进行下一步、F7代表STEP RETURN从目标方法的方法体内出来、F8代表RESUME忽略当前断点并进入下一个断点的调试.
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: